16.10.2011
TOTTENHAM HOTSPUR LADIES FC U13 WHITES 3
LITTLE THURROCK DYNAMOS U13 1
Essex County Girl's Football League U13 "A" Division
A chilly Sunday mid morning saw Spurs ladies U13 Whites welcome Little Thurrock Dynamo's to Freddie Knights.

Thurrock were top of the league and with the Whites having had an indifferent start to the season, nerves were apparent.  The sun soon shone down on Spurs, when newly appointed captain Niamh Carty smashed in an unstoppable shot from angle on the edge of the box.  Spurs continued to enjoy possession in well contested, physical game in which Emily Stacey stood out.

The defence of Joely, Georgia, Lois and Carlota were all good on the ball today. The midfield of Klea, Tayla, Morgan, Heidi and Sophie were tenacious and never gave up.  Special thanks to Heidi and Sophie's goalkeeping stints !


The second goal came for Spurs after another good run and shot from Klea that deflected in off of a Thurrock player. Play continued Spurs' way and then Niamh smashed in another unstoppable shot from the opposite angle to her first goal with her left foot to make it 3-1 final score to Spurs.

13.11.2011
TOTTENHAM HOTSPUR LADIES FC U13 WHITES 3
TIGER BLACK SOCKS U13 4
Essex County Girl's Football League U13 "A" Division
A beautiful yet unusual November afternoon saw Spurs welcome top of the league Tiger Black Socks to Freddie Knights.   Spurs really needed a win and would go one point in front at the top of the league if achieved.

The game started at breakneck speed with end to end stuff from the kick off.  The nerves were etched on the faces of both sets of coaches and parents.  Tigers went 1-0 ahead, but Spurs did not let this affect us as Klea Sadrija soon levelled the score. 

Some amazing play from both teams ensued when all of a sudden, after a good attack, Niamh Carty somehow managed to squeeze in a shot to give Spurs a 2-1 lead.  Tigers would not rest and a poorly defended Spurs free kick resulted in Tigers smashing in a second goal.  2-2 and game on.

The second half was equally frenetic and Spurs were in heaven when Klea put us 3-2 up after a defensive mix up from Tigers.  The one advantage that Tigers had over us was that they had fresh legs waiting to come on during the second half, but Spurs were down to the bare nine players today, and then Sophie suffered a horrible injury defending what was to be Tigers equaliser.  3-3 and Spurs were down to eight players.

Tayla Jackson, herself a hero for not being fully fit but playing, took over in goal.  The end to end continued when suddenly out of nowhere came the moment we all dreaded, Tigers scored what was to be the winner in what was probably the best game of our season so far.

A 4-3 loss but lots of positives to be had from an excellent team performance.

Man of the match went to Heidi Yelkin who had a supreme game playing out of position in defence.

26.02.2012
TOTTENHAM HOTSPUR LADIES FC U13 WHITES 5
CORRINGHAM COSMOS U13 2
Essex County Girl's Football League U13 - Spring Plate Div. 1

The Spurs Ladies Under-13 Whites welcomed Corringham Cosmos for a Spring Plate Division 1 league game at a sunny Fredrick Knights.  The Tottenham girls were at a disadvantage even before kick off as only 8 of the squad turned out.

Corringham kicked off and the opening five minutes was end to end stuff with both teams going close, but it was the Cosmos who took the lead, when a deep cross caught out the Spurs defence and an unmarked girl on the far post poked the ball in the back of the net from three yards out. Cosmos lead 0-1.

From the re-start it didn’t take long before the girls were level when a great through ball from Morgan Leversuch found Klea Sadrija, who shook off a challenge to fire a great shot in the bottom left hand corner for the equaliser. 1-1.

Cosmos made a few changes and were pressing forward but the defending of Joley Harris-Tharp, Morgan and Carlota Franques were excellent.

Naimh Carty picked up a loose ball on the right and with no support nearby decided to go alone and by holding off three challenges managed to shoot from a tight angle and find the back of the net. A great individual goal. 2-1

Heidi Yelkin on the left and Tayla Jackson on the right were running their socks off helping out defending and breaking forward.  A break away from Cosmos led to a 50/50 ball between the Cosmos striker and the Spurs keeper Sophie Aldridge and it was the brave Sophie who came out best with a great diving save.  With the game still evenly balanced a Cosmos corner found its way in the back of the net for an equaliser. 2-2.

Once again the Spurs girls responded well and another Naimh goal from the edge of the box put the girls back in front just before the half time whistle. 3-2.

Tottenham went off at half time leading 3-2 and needing a well-deserved drink and rest.

Spurs got the second half underway and like the first half, it was pretty much end to end stuff. Cosmos had some good chances, but Sophie made some great saves and was catching the ball well.  Another great ball out of defence from Morgan led to Naimh getting a well-deserved hat-trick.  Naimh latched on to the through ball and made no mistake with an unstoppable shot. 4-2.

With around five minutes to go Joley pushed up front and found herself running on to a through ball from the halfway line, being chased by a defender Joley stayed strong and slotted the ball in the back of the net for her first goal for the club.  The girls mobbed Joley to share her joy and us parents on the side-lines were nearly holding back Joley's Dad from joining them. He has waited nearly four years for that moment.  5-2.

The Spurs girls played well today and could have scored a few more with a great run from Carlota, who just couldn’t get a shot in, Klea came close a few times, Tayla headed just over and Heidi shooting just wide.

Final score : Tottenham Hotspur Ladies  5    Corringham Cosmos   2

Girl of the match went to Naimh for a great all round performance and a hat-trick.

11.03.2012
TIGER BLACK SOCKS U13 4
TOTTENHAM HOTSPUR LADIES FC U13 WHITES 5
Essex County Girl's Football League U13  - Spring Plate Div. 1
A beautiful Spring like morning saw us travel to Romford for a game against Tiger Black Socks who we had played against in our last league.  We knew we were in for a very tough morning, as we were again down to the bare nine players, and we had already had some mammoth games against Tigers already.

The game started at frenetic pace, with end to end stuff.  Spurs were off to a flyer when a very alert Heidi Yelkin intercepted a Tigers goal kick and squared to Niamh Carty, who ruthlessly fired home. 1-0 to Spurs.

The re-start saw the ball won by Morgan Leversuch in our box, and she cleverly played in Heidi, who again being very alert, looked up and squared to Klea Sadrija from a left wing position. Klea then slotted the ball beautifully into the left hand corner of the Tigers goal. 2-0 Spurs. Some scrappy play ensued, and Lois Pennington pulled off a couple of brilliant tackles to keep Tigers at bay, and along with Sophie Aldridge commanding the area and closing down well, Spurs were well on top, but by half time, two defensive lapses found Spurs pegged back to 2-2.
 

After an inspiring team talk from the writer of this report at half time, the girls went out fired up and within a minute of the re-start, some exceptional play on the left side of the pitch from Heidi and Klea saw Niamh put through to again ruthlessly smash Spurs into a 3-2 lead.

We again won possession via the industrious Tayla Jackson from the re-start, who found Joely Harris-Tharp in space. Joely turned and passed to Georgia Callegari who went on a mazy run, shot, the keeper saved, but luckily for us Niamh was poaching and tapped in. 4-2 and we were in heaven.

The re-start saw Spurs now in total control, almost instantly taking the ball off of Tigers thanks to a Morgan interception. Morgan found Georgia with a simple pass, and some wonderful left side play involving Heidi and Niamh saw Niamh go on to nick a fourth goal for herself and a fifth for Spurs. 3 goals in 10 minutes.


Tigers pegged Spurs back after this and Lois had to go off injured after one of Tigers attacks, due to her commitment in throwing herself in the way of everything, and showing some supreme defensive covering.  In true grit style, she soon came back on.

While we were down to eight players, the girls showed excellent team spirit in covering each others positions.  Sophie was in blistering form, saving our bacon on more than one occasion.  Spurs broke out after a period of pressure but again two defensive lapses saw Tigers claim two goals back. 

With the score at 5-4 in Spurs' favour, we were nervous, and not helped when a Tigers shot that Sophie saved caused an injury to Sophie as it trapped her hand against the post.  Sophie had to come out of goal with a seriously swollen hand, but without question, Tayla volunteered to take over and steadied everyone's nerves with a fine display.  Sophie almost scored too.


The game finished 5-4 to Spurs and all players, parents, helpers and writer of this report were extremely proud. Player of the match could have been anyone today, so the Haribo's went to all of the girls.  Well done girls.
